Hold up.
Oval door the window regulator is in a different spot, not buy much but it is different if I remember correct so no your door panels are going to be different on split vs early oval.
The second thing you need to look at Steven is that you can EASILY tell a split door from a Oval door, check out an Oval door where the vent wing is if your looking down the window channel there is a little bump inward to where it would meet up to the vent wing, a split window door the window channel is the same size all the way down there is not a little lip or a little bump on there. _________________ I own a copy of "The Car of the Century" by Garwood. | Yustrn is correct, exactly what he says in addition the door check strap is a slot on an split door and a hole on an oval door. If I recall correctly the bottom bracket built into the door for a split window door regulator is different or not present on an oval door, but I am old and its been a long time since I owned a split. |

| steven wood wrote: |
| on split doors, are the interior door handles in different locations than early oval doors? |
Yes they are. The window crank is in the same position, but the door handle is a half-inch higher on the split door. _________________ We are striving for perfection, to make our cars run forever, if possible.
